Output 293fa66776db95d8ddc111a13db9e831f5c78a92a51c2bf6cf9365ebf2058764:1

value
10241863
script pubkey
OP_0 OP_PUSHBYTES_20 89d3386ac3ed137b0a18286afc136015436fba01
address
bc1q38fns6kra5fhkzsc9p40cymqz4pklwspn6ulxn
transaction
293fa66776db95d8ddc111a13db9e831f5c78a92a51c2bf6cf9365ebf2058764
spent
true